While Li's method to produce hardened wood is new, wood processing in general has been around for centuries.
However, when wood is prepared for furniture or building materials, it is only processed with steam and compression, and the material rebounds somewhat after shaping. Even though it's often used in building, wood's strength falls short of that of cellulose.
Li and his team sought to process wood in such a way to remove the weaker components while not destroying the cellulose skeleton. Typically, wood is very rigid, but after removal of the lignin, it becomes soft, flexible, and somewhat squishy.
In the second step, we do a hot press by applying pressure and heat to the chemically processed wood to densify and remove the water. After the material is processed and carved into the desired shape, it is coated in mineral oil to extend its lifetime. Cellulose tends to absorb water, so this coating preserves the knife's sharpness during use and when it is washed in the sink or dishwasher.
Using high-resolution microscopy, Li and his team examined the microstructure of the hardened wood to determine the origin of its strength. This wood-hardening process has the potential to be more energy efficient and have a lower environmental impact than for the manufacture of other human-made materials, although more in-depth analysis is necessary to say for sure. For comparison, the process used to make ceramics requires heating materials up to a few thousand degrees Celsius.
